Ireland Go for Six Appeal Against US Eagles

Ireland A have included six full capped players in their side to play the USA in their opening pool game of the Barclays Churchill Cup in Kingston on Wednesday.

Coach Allen Clarke has picked a blend of youth and experience for the encounter.

Johnny O'Connor is part of a capped back row along side Neil Best and Roger Wilson.

The side includes Heineken Cup winners Denis Hurley and Tomás O'Leary as well as Magners League winner Jonathan Sexton.

Fresh from Ireland Sevens duty, Brian Tuohy makes up the back three alongside Hurley and Mark McCrea.

There is an all Munster look to the midfield with Keith Earls and Kirean Lewis completing the back line.

In the forwards, captain Bob Casey is partnered in the second row by Ryan Caldwell.

The front row comprises Leinster tyro Cian Healy alongside Denis Fogarty and Harlequins' Mike Ross.
